Specific Conditions:
1.This Consent to establish is being granted to HOSPITAL EQUIPMENT MANUFACTURING
COMPANY for its unit for establishment of an industry at D-312, Sector-63, NOIDA, GAUTAM
BUDDHA NAGAR, for production of Medical & surgical items
2.This Consent to Establish will be VOID if there is any change in above mentioned address or
product.
3.Unit shall comply with the CAQM (Commission for Air Quality Management in NCR and
Adjoining Areas) direction no. 53,55, 62 to 65 & 68 and other direction issued time to time
regarding use of cleaner fuel and any other directions that CAQM gives in this context.
4.Industry shall ensure to Compliance of CAQM Direction no.-71 dated 09-02-2023 i.e.-“NOW,
THEREFORE, with a view to comprehensively prevent, control and abate air pollution caused by
the DG sets in the region, the commission in exercise of its powers vested under Section 12 of the
Commission for Air Quality Management in NCR and Adjoining Areas Act 2021, hereby directs that
w.e.f. 15-05-2023, for periods other than ban/ restrictions under the GRAP, any use of DG sets of
capacity up to 800 kw shall be permitted for industrial and commercial sector in the entire NCR,
only subject to their conversion to dual fuel system (70 % Gas+30 % Diesel) in areas where gas
infrastructure and supply is available.”
5.Industry shall ensure to Compliance of Addendum to Direction No: 65 dated 03-04-2023 i.e.-
“Standard list of approved fuels for entire NCR- Diesel (BS VI with 10 ppm Sulphur) as per
Notification of Government of India as amended from time to time - Vehicular fuel and fuel for
Power Generating Set.”
6.WATER POLLUTING PROCESS LIKE SURFACE TREATMENT (ELECTROPLATING /
PICKLING / PHOSPHATING / PAINTING etc.) WILL NOT BE ALLOWED.
7.Under the Noise Pollution (Regulation and Control) Rule 2000, the industry shall take adequate
measures for control of noise from its own sources within the premises so as to maintain ambient air
quality standards in respect of noise to less than 75 dB(A) during day time and 70 dB(A).
8.Industry shall ensure adequate plantation and green belt within its premises. Green cover shall be
in compliance of approved map from concerned Authority.
9.Industry will not use of any type of fuel and water in industrial process.
10.Industry will not allow discharging any type of industrial effluent or air emission.
11.Industry has to install Rain Water Harvesting system.
12.Prior to abstraction, industry shall obtain a No Objection Certificate from Central Ground Water
Authority for abstraction of ground water.
13.Industry shall comply with various Waste Management Rules as notified by MoEf & CC i.e.
Plastic Waste Management Rules, 2016, Solid Waste Management Rules, 2016, Hazardous and
Other Wastes (Management and Trans boundary) Rules, 2016, E-waste (Management) Rules, 2016,
Construction and Demolition Waste Management Rules, 2016(as applicable).
14.Industry shall abide by directions given by Hon'ble Supreme Court, High Court, National Green
Tribunals, Central Pollution Control Board and Uttar Pradesh Pollution Control Board for protection
and safeguard of environment from time to time.
15.The industry shall adhere to general standards terms and conditions of Water/Air Acts and
compliance of Environment standards as per Environment (protection) Act 1986.
16.In case of violation of above mentioned conditions or any public complaint the consent shall be
withdrawn.
17.Industry shall submit first compliance report with respect to conditions imposed within 30 days of
issue of this permission.
